Vivo has been gradually revealing details about its upcoming foldable, the Vivo X Fold 5, ahead of its official launch in China. Though there have been a lot of teasers about several key features, the chipset was an unknown—until now. The upcoming Vivo device, likely the X Fold 5, has done a round of Geekbench to reveal the chip and some other specifications.

Vivo X Fold 5 with Snapdragon 8 Gen 3, Apple Ecosystem Support, 6000mAh Battery Set for June 25 Launch
The model number of the device is listed as V2436A while the device is currently running on the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 chipset, going by the information on the CPU and the GPU on the benchmark listing. This is the same chip found in last year’s China-only Vivo X Fold 3. And despite the competition like the Oppo Find N5 and Honor Magic V5 using a new 8 Gen 3 Elite variant, Vivo has gone for the vanilla Gen 3 chip — perhaps aiming for a more accessible price point.
According to the listing, the phone features 16GB of RAM and runs on Android 15. It scored 2,270 points in the single-core test and 6,913 points in the multi-core test. The Vivo X Fold 5 is scheduled to launch in China on June 25.
It will house a massive 6,000mAh battery yet maintain a sleek design, measuring just 4.3mm when unfolded. The phone will be available in Pine Green, White, and Titanium and come with an IP59+ rating, making it dust- and water-resistant, and functional at temperatures as low as -20°C.
Photography will be a highlight, with a 50MP periscope telephoto camera offering long-range zoom and macro capabilities. Uniquely, Vivo claims the X Fold 5 is the first Android phone to connect seamlessly with Apple devices—including iPhone calls, messages, AirPods, iCloud, and Apple Watch—along with cross-device file transfer and productivity tools with Mac, enhancing the experience for hybrid users.
